Northrop Grumman Defense Systems is seeking an Engineering Technician 1 to join our team of qualified, diverse individuals in Warner Robins, GA. Engineering Technician 1 is responsible for supporting repair, production and manufacturing processes. Will repair, modify, and maintain a variety of electronic equipment and Electronic Warfare systems. You will be repairing highly complex systems and equipment that are mission critical for the platforms that they operate on.

In this role, the selected candidate will be expected to the following and other similar tasks:

  • Performs a variety of tasks ranging from repetitive to non-repetitive production assembly operations and solder workon electronic and/or mechanical assemblies and subassemblies such as modules, boards, panels, drawers, frames, and cables.

  • Works from diagrams and drawings, makes initial layouts, and uses hand and/or power tools, jigs, and saws.

  • Makes continuity checks on work in process and completed. May conduct quality inspections on processing line in accordance with quality specifications.

  • May disassemble, modify, rework, reassemble, and test experimental or prototype assemblies and subassemblies according to specifications and under simulated conditions.

Basic Qualifications:

  • A high school diploma or equivalent (GED)with relevant soldering, production, or assembly experience being a plus

  • Ability to work 2nd shift as required

  • Ability to wear safety gear, such as steel toed shoes and glasses

  • Ability to handle and assemble small parts

  • Ability to frequently move and position objects weighing up to 50 lbs.

  • Ability to work on-site in Warner Robins, Georgia

  • Must be able to obtain and maintain DoD Secret Security Clearance

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Computer skills including proficiency with MS Word and Excel.

  • Experience with soldering electronics components and assemblies.
